11th Century Romanesque Art: The Enchanting Tapestry of Creation or Girona The Tapestry of Creation, also known as the Girona Tapestry, is an exquisite example of Romanesque art from the 11th century, now proudly displayed at the Museum of the Cathedral in Girona, Catalonia, Spain.
